Team 8: “We prepared strategies with a mind to win”

[image loading]

With a string of strategic plays, Team 8 beat SK Telecom T1 in just 53 minutes. (Z)Jaedong’s 5pool, (P)Tyson’s 3gate all in rush, and (P)Jaehoon’s quick zealot reaver attack took down (T)Ssak, (P)Bisu, (P)BeSt. Team 8: “with a mind to win no matter what, our strategies ran away with the match from set 1.”

Q: You followed up your complete loss with a complete win.
(P)Jaehoon: In the last match, I felt bad for my teammates because I lost so fast. If I’d won, the momentum might have been different.

Q: Were you guys expecting a 3-0
(P)Tyson: Our team has a lot of strong players, so I thought as long as I won, it’d be a 3-0.
(P)Jaehoon: With the score at 2-0, I was sure I could make it 3-0.

Q: You prepared a 5pool today
(Z)Jaedong: I thought it might be good to use it once in a while. Honestly, right before the match I almost changed my mind, but my coach reassured me. I was single-minded from then on. And because I had good luck with starting positions I was able to win.

Q: How does it feel to win with such surprise tactics
(Z)Jaedong: It always feels good to win. Because it ended so quickly I feel unfulfilled, but the win feels good like any other win.

Q: Your strategies seemed really prepared
(P)Jaehoon: You could tell we’d prepared a lot. As soon as I spawned at 9, I thought I’d won. It gave me confidence because Chain Reaction has a lot of income imbalance in starting locations. We were stressed out polishing and honing them countless times.
(P)Tyson: Although I mentioned (P)Kal in the tv interview, I didn’t learn it from him, but our ex-teammate (P)Lazy. We made it together, then Kal helped us refine it through practice. I want to thank both players.

Q: Did you have any worries about facing (P)Bisu
(P)Tyson: I played it with my eyes shut, flat-out assuming no dt builds. I played thinking I’d win no matter what happened.
(P)Jaehoon: I think you did a good job of it (laughs).

Q: You play STX next.
(P)Jaehoon: STX has really strong momentum right now. (T)Last and (P)mini are pretty good but if (Z)Jaedong takes out their ace (T)Bogus I can see them falling.
(P)Tyson: I’ll go in trusting (Z)Jaedong.
(Z)Jaedong: It doesn’t matter to me who I face. The important thing is to win no matter who it is.

Q: Anything you want to say.
(P)Jaehoon: I was going to do something for my mother’s birthday on Jan. 29, but I forgot. I was always sorry I had never sent her a present or said thank you [t/n tsk tsk, Jaehoon]. I want to take this opportunity to say thank you to her.
(P)Tyson: It feels good to take down the mighty SKT1. We’ll close out round 2 by beating STX as well.
(Z)Jaedong: Compared to other teams, it feels like our fans are the most vocal and passionate. Although we’re in last place right now, I want to pay back their embarrassment by slowly climbing up the rankings and reaching the post season.

[Daily e-Sports reporter Park Song-ee raki@dailyesports.com]
Source: DES
